So the idea here is that I will model stuff that I to tend encounter during my daily routine ... only, make it a little bit more fantastic. I will keep the visual style the same, but the theme will probably vary.

All models come with a free, baked ambient occlusion map! Lighting/shadows not included (though I have suggestions).

DOWNLOAD LINKS ADDED
OBJ, X and FBX are included in each 7z file.

Baked AO is a nice idea ...
Yeah, I was initially thinking of baking shadows and lighting, but that really doesn't give the part 2 people much freedom. AO gives makes an object feel very tactile, and compliments whatever lighting system is then put on top.
